Chrome浏览器

首页 > 如何通过开发者工具提升Google Chrome的页面渲染速度

如何通过开发者工具提升Google Chrome的页面渲染速度

来源:Chrome浏览器官网时间:2025-05-28

详情介绍 m详情介绍

如何通过开发者工具提升Google Chrome的页面渲染速度1

一、基础性能分析
1. 打开开发者工具
- 使用快捷键Ctrl+Shift+I或F12
- 在菜单栏选择“更多工具”进入开发工具
- 点击“Rendering”面板查看渲染统计信息
- 在扩展商店安装Lighthouse直接生成报告
2. 检查加载性能指标
- 在Network面板查看首次内容绘制(FCP)时间
- 使用Performance面板录制页面加载过程
- 通过Filmstrip图表定位卡顿时间点
- 在控制台输入`window.performance.now()`测试脚本执行耗时
3. 优化资源加载顺序
- 在源代码中将CSS放在头部JS放在底部
- 使用async属性异步加载非关键JavaScript
- 通过Preload链接预加载重要资源文件
- 在Network面板禁用不必要的请求类型
二、渲染优化技术
1. 减少重绘与重排
- 在Styles面板检查强制同步属性(如width)
- 使用Flexbox布局替代传统浮动布局
- 通过will-change属性提示GPU加速
- 在控制台输入`document.body.style.overflow`测试滚动影响
2. 优化图像处理
- 在Elements面板检查图像实际显示尺寸
- 使用srcset实现响应式图片加载
- 通过picture元素替代object标签
- 在扩展商店安装ImageOptim压缩无损优化工具
3. 字体加载策略
- 在Sources面板查看字体文件加载时序
- 使用@font-face定义Web字体优先级
- 通过font-display: swap实现无闪烁替换
- 在控制台输入`FontFaceSet.ready.then()`检测加载状态
三、高级调试技巧
1. Layers面板应用
- 在Rendering面板启用“图层边界”可视化
- 使用contain属性限制图层渲染范围
- 通过transform: layer创建独立渲染层
- 在扩展商店安装LayerWhiz自动优化图层结构
2. 动画性能检测
- 在Animations面板查看CSS动画帧率
- 使用requestAnimationFrame替代setTimeout
- 通过Timeline图表识别长时间任务
- 在控制台输入`window.requestIdleCallback()`处理低优先级任务
3. 内存泄漏诊断
- 在Memory面板拍摄堆快照对比差异
- 使用Audits面板运行内存泄漏检测
- 通过WeakMap管理DOM节点引用关系
- 在扩展商店安装HeapSnapshot自动分析工具
继续阅读 m继续阅读
Chrome浏览器下载加速操作简便直观。方法解析帮助用户快速获取文件,提高下载速度,操作效率提升,整体体验更加顺畅。 2025-12-22 谷歌浏览器在智能办公场景下支持文档协作、插件扩展和任务管理,本文展示其应用价值,帮助用户提升办公效率和工作便捷性。 2025-12-08 Google Chrome浏览器跨平台下载操作方法易用。文章结合实用步骤,帮助用户在不同设备快速下载安装,提高操作效率和使用便捷性。 2025-12-29 google Chrome浏览器官方渠道提供快速安装方法,用户可高效完成部署。保证官方版本稳定运行,并减少安装失败风险。 2025-12-23 Chrome浏览器插件更新后闪退影响使用稳定,本文介绍回滚和兼容性处理方法,帮助用户快速恢复插件正常运行,保证浏览体验流畅。 2025-12-06 Chrome浏览器启动速度可以通过多种技巧优化,本教程分享操作经验,帮助用户提升启动效率、优化性能,改善整体浏览器使用体验。 2025-12-26 Chrome浏览器AI智能推荐功能可提供个性化网页内容,用户通过深度使用教程掌握推荐设置,提高浏览效率,实现更精准的上网体验。 2025-12-04 Chrome浏览器提示权限不足时,可能因存储路径、系统策略或账户控制受限,调整访问权限后可恢复下载功能。 2025-12-13 分享谷歌浏览器下载完成后打开卡顿问题的优化建议,提升浏览器启动和运行效率。 2025-11-30 谷歌浏览器密码管理功能提供安全存储和自动填表操作,用户可有效管理账号密码,提高登录效率和安全性。 2025-12-05
回到顶部